#613d66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#613d66 is composed of 38% red, 23.9%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.9%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 292.7 degrees, a saturation of 25.2% and a lightness of 32%. #613d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#c27acc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#613d66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#faf7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#613d66
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535053 is the less saturated color, while #8c059e is the most saturated one.
